Checking the Voltages on
the AWG1G Board
AWG5000B and AWG5000C Series Service Manual
To measure the output voltages of the PWR board, check the voltages at J2000
on the AWG1G board with the digital multimeter and compare each reading to
the values listed in the following table. If the voltages are within the allowance,
your PWR board is functional.
